  • Two years ago, to mark Father’s Day, I sat in the closet I’m sitting in now (which you can see only in your mind’s eye), and had an extraordinary conversation with Dr. Talmadge E. King, Jr., a world-renowned lung specialist who is dean of the Medical School at the University of California, San Francisco. Dr. King and I talked about his father, Talmadge King Senior, who was born in 1922 in the segregated south.  I loved our conversation, and it seems fitting to post the interview today, on June 19th, 2022. Mr. King, who died in 2018, would be 100 this year.

    Talmadge Senior was so beloved a member of the community in Darien, Georgia that the town recruited him as the first Black police officer when the police force was first integrated.

    He instilled in his five children a sense of doing better with each successive generation. He offered a simple metaphor: "If your father builds a wooden house, it's your responsibility to build a brick house."
